Creating a Speech Synthesis Markup Language File

In addition to allowing TTS with strings, the speech synthesizer allows you to define speech using the Speech Synthesis Markup Language (SSML). SSML offers a powerful language for authoring TTS scripts.

The structure of an SSML document consists of a root speak element, which has an xml:lang attribute that determines the default speaking voice used. See Listing 23.18.

Voice elements define sections of speech that allow the speaking voice to be customized, including gender and language.

The stress and intonation of the speech can be modified using the prosody element, allowing you to vary the volume and pitch of a word or speech fragment. For more detailed information on the prosody element, see ...

